Former Republic of Ireland midfielder Mark Kinsella has taken his first steps into full-time management in the SSE Airtricty league after being named interim Drogheda United manager this afternoon. The former Charlton and Aston Villa player was assistant to Johnny McDonnell who resigned on Sunday morning after the 4-1 weekend loss to Limerick city.
